GranPaSmurf 108 Posted May 24, 2018 Share Posted May 24, 2018 (edited) I'm sorry you are having trouble with Synergy. Step 1 for an easy fix is restarting Synergy service on all the machines. Step 2 easy fix is the restart the Synergy-core. The easy way is to mouse-grab one of the screen images in the Synergy UI and move it away a bit, disengaging it from the other(s), waiting a couple of seconds and reassembling to your liking. Step 3 Another trick I recently learned is going the saved msi installation file, right-clicking and choosing 'repair.' That sometimes gets things back on track. Step 4 not so easy is to reinstall. I see you've done several reinstalls. Every version of Synergy leaves behind some files when it is uninstalled by the usual methods and some of them affect the configuration of subsequent installations. When I am trouble-shooting Synergy, I use a 3rd party uninstaller to be sure I get everything. Nick says I'm going to too much trouble, but I think it saves me time.
